An ecosystem is a community of living organisms which interact among themselves and with their non-living physical environment to sustain their lives. An ecosystem typically consists of abiotic (non-living) and biotic (living) components which are linked together for the energy flow and nutrient cycling.
The changes in an ecosystem will occur if the non-living and living components of the ecosystem change this will bring instability to the ecosystem. For example, water body like river a non-living factor if get dried it will affect the life cycle of the aquatic animals. Therefore, this will bring instability to the ecosystem.
